Yang Water

​Character
Yang Water is best represented by large areas of water like lakes, oceans, or large rivers. Its water is constantly moving; therefore, Yang Water people are very dynamic and like to move from place to place all the time. Like water, which can go around objects and find a path through any crack, Yang Water people are very adaptable and can go around problems much better than other elements. Their nature is diplomatic, and they do not use force; they simply find another way to get what they want. This is the element type that achieves whatever it wants just because it wants to be free. If success does not happen for a Yang Water, it will go nowhere in life and become a drifter. The entire impetus of Yang Water people is their thirst for freedom; Yang Waters dislike being controlled or locked in. So, either they will be very successful, or they will lose themselves and completely waste their lives.

Intelligence is the main characteristic of Yang Water people, as they have an outstanding ability to learn and can absorb information from different fields in a very easy and natural way. Yang Water people are natural-born entrepreneurs with an outstanding ability to reproduce ideas and businesses they notice in their surroundings. One of the best examples is Bill Gates, who built a software empire by simply copying what other people had made and repackaging it into a new range of products for the mass market.

Yang Waters are so-called reflectors, like an ocean that reflects and reproduces sunlight; that's how they reproduce ideas. Yang Waters appear creative but are actually very fast and detailed imitators. Water has no color; it reflects the sky or trees and whatever is around it at the speed of light. Copy and paste sums them up; they see something and just copy and paste it everywhere and anywhere it works.

Yang Water can easily see the big picture; therefore, they are very good business tacticians. There is always something going on with Yang Water, like a deep ocean that carries new ideas ready to come up to the surface at any time. They like social life, being with people, and trying all kinds of things just for fun. They don't like to be tied down and are very unpredictable about their next move, which sometimes can even cause a certain amount of anxiety because they are not often able to settle on one thing.

Although their nature is to run free, it's very good for Yang Water to have boundaries; otherwise, the water will spill everywhere and will have no direction. Therefore, the best way to control Yang Water and give it boundaries is with Yang Earth, or even Yin Earth, if it's strong enough to handle the water.

Yang Water has a very systematic, quick, and sharp thought process. They can visualize the problem, see it from different angles, take the big picture into account, and then come up with a solution. If a person is a well-balanced Yang Water, their thought processes rarely get distracted by emotions. Still, in the case of a weak or overly strong Yang Water, their emotions can get in the way and cloud their judgment.

If they are not able to come up with satisfying conclusions, they will ask lots of questions until they can. If Yang Water is weak, they can become too analytical and might not be able to finish the process. Yang Water has an excellent memory, like a deep sea that holds various treasures and creatures deep down. Yang Water is able to memorize things they find important and pull them out of the depths every time they need them, surprising everybody around. Their memory is selective, and things that they don't want to keep are simply erased and lost forever in the depths of the ocean.

Yang Waters like to impress people with their skills, latest discoveries, or any bit ​of new information. Their self-confidence relies very much on what people think about them, so they need to keep up a smart appearance. A highly developed Yang Water enjoys its superiority and rarely accepts to play second fiddle. Therefore, they will do anything to get to the top. Less developed Yang Water people might suffer from inferiority complexes and as a result, sometimes they withdraw from society to avoid such situations. In fact, being useless is one of Yang Water's biggest fears, and when the situation arises, they like to go into action immediately, just to boost their self-esteem. As long as they are in constant movement, Yang Water is healthy and keeps developing.

It's essential to understand that all these qualities come into question when Yang Water is too strong, which means it floods over and all around, and it's directionless. In that case, the person might be pessimistic and emotional. To have the positive qualities of Yang Water, the water has to be in a state of healthy balance, or instead, it will be in opposition to any positive attributes.

Work
If Yang Water loves their job, they will motivate themselves to do their best, and there is no need to look over their shoulders. If one day they don't see the purpose of their work, they will simply leave, regardless of whether another job is waiting for them or not. They do not waste time at work, but if they want to entertain themselves with something, they will do so, clearly and openly. With their co-workers, they are sociable and diplomatic, and they get along quite easily with everybody.

Highly developed Yang Water does not engage in power struggles with their colleagues; they have their focus on something far bigger. The less developed Yang Water tends to be involved in lots of dramas and petty disputes among its co-workers.

Business
Yang Waters don't like to take risks or spend money; they will turn every coin over five times before they decide to spend it. So getting money out of Yang Water is very hard unless they are paying for something they are really into. They are the great copycats of all the element types, and they like to stick to things that have been proven to work. As they are quick to catch onto anything around about, they need to decide on their career so they do not become insignificant jacks of all trades. In cooperation with suitable partners, they can go beyond their tendency to be limited and become truly great. In fact, Yang Waters are very good managers and leaders; they take care of every aspect of the business, especially making sure that all the paperwork is clear and the costs are down!

They are fully aware of what their business associates and colleagues are doing and ready anytime to ask the right questions to stay in the loop. As leaders, they enjoy sharing opinions with their colleagues and subordinates, as they have an open mind and will count them in, but that doesn't mean they will follow everything people tell them. In the case of a less developed Yang Water, the opinions of others can make them confused and make them constantly change their minds, due to a lack of inner control and direction. A highly developed Yang Water has a good sense for business, marketing, finances, risk management, and creating business plans. They usually have good connections, but their pride sometimes stops them from asking for help – which can prove to be their ultimate downfall.

On the other hand, either too strong or too weak Yang Water might be too calculative, pessimistic, and over-analytical, so their business prospects will be rather low. A good Yang Water always has a big picture of their business and is able to see the connection between the now and the future. Yang Waters are simply dreamers but with the ability to bring those dreams to reality, but only if their water is well-balanced or is going through a lucky element period.

Wealth
Yang Waters are conservative spenders, and usually, it takes them a long time to make the first step. But once they have collected all the necessary information about a certain business, they go fully in, ready and keen to make it huge and reach their ultimate goal: financial freedom. When it comes to investments, Yang Waters rarely use advice from specialists, although they might ask questions. They like doing their research and making up their minds. One of the best examples is Warren Buffet, who made a fortune simply by following his own system of investments. He would rarely take risks and would go only for particular investments in which he fully believed.

Friendship and Relationship
Being the water element, Yang Water always seeks balance, and people often come to them for advice, knowing they will give them right-minded advice. They do not talk much, but when they do, they are honest, sometimes even brutally honest. The water element also likes to keep itself clean, therefore it will always try to find a way out of a troubling relationship or dodgy business partnership. They simply cannot handle any kind of relationship drama; that's just not their thing!

Yang Water makes friends easily; connecting with everything around is their natural state, and people are attracted to them like thirsty men to water. In their free time, they like to attend big parties, dances, or anything that involves people and movement. But due to their dual and moody nature, which is typical for water people, not many people can get near enough to fully understand Yang Water, and only a few get access to their true feelings.

​You are Yang Water Ren if your daymaster is the Water Rat, Water Tiger, Water Dragon, Water Horse, Water Monkey, or Water Dog. Yang Water is symbolized by vast oceans, great lakes, and rapid rivers. Ren Water people prefer freedom of movement and a carefree lifestyle and strongly dislike pressure and confrontations. They are extroverted, optimistic, resourceful, and artistic lovers of poetry and dance. They also make excellent businesspeople. Like a rushing river, Ren Waters are frequently on the go. Movement and activity are important for their emotional and physical well-being. As the saying goes, still waters run deep, and it is sometimes difficult to "read" the Ren Water person. Dynamic and focused, Ren Waters can be myopic when they have their minds set on something or someone. Inconsistent and temperamental, their moods tend to swell and recede like the tide. Compassionate, attentive, empathic, and warm, Ren Water persons sometimes care too much and may suffer from giving more than they receive. These are the good Samaritans of the 10 heavenly stems. Unfortunately, they may become so concerned about advocating and spreading love and goodwill that they overlook the nuts-and-bolts practicalities of helping. Ren Waters almost always have good intentions; however, their hidden compulsion is neediness - a need to be needed, appreciated, and loved - but they often avoid recognizing those needs.

The Ren Water female is challenging to understand and please. Demanding, sometimes snappish, and disdainful of weakness, she tends to have high expectations of her partner. Love is always confusing for the Ren Water woman. Should she select a dominant, influential man who rebuffs her testy demeanor, or a romantic, sweet man who is always available and ready to carry out her wishes? Truthfully, she would love to have both available for her, depending on her mood du jour.

The Ren Water male is the classic strong, silent type. Never one for small talk or meaningless verbal banter, the Ren Water man says what he means and means what he says. His affections will be expressed in tangible ways such as gifts or financial assistance. Although he is not verbally effusive with his declarations of passion, he is highly sentimental and will enjoy the little gestures and romantic things that you do. The Ren Water man will almost always be a successful businessman, manager, or entrepreneur, but he'll probably be just as married to his job as he is to you. Nurture and facilitate his career, and you will endear yourself to him forever.

If you are a Yang Water Ren:
  • Your sudden, unexpected wealth/windfall element is Yang Fire (Bing).
  • Your entitled, earned wealth/property element is Yin Fire (Ding).
  • Your happiness/guardian/proper care element is Yin Metal (Xin).
  • Your beneficial/positive change/angel element is Yin Earth (Ji).
  • Your unfavorable/conflict/unbecoming/harmful element is Yang Earth (Wu).
    ​
As a Yang Water Ren, the Water element represents you, your companions, spouse, and any rivals you may have. This element endows you with communication skills and makes you intuitive and deep. You may also have a strong yearning to travel and explore. Yang Water years (2002, 2012) bring companions, helpers, and cooperative associations, while Yin Water years (2003, 2013) may bring competitors or rivals. The Wood element represents your offspring as well as your ideas, and both Yang and Yin Wood years (2004, 2005, 2014, 2015) facilitate creativity and expression.

The Fire element represents your finances and your father. Yang Fire years (2006, 2016) bring sudden and unexpected wealth, while Yin Fire years (2007, 2017) bring good luck with earned wealth. The Metal element represents your mother, as well as caretakers, mentors, and those who support and protect you. Yin Metal years (2001, 2011, 2021) bring nurturing and happiness, while Yang Metal years (2000, 2010, 2020) may feel smothering or oppressive.

The Earth element represents your career or vocation, but can be difficult as it traps your Water daymaster. Yang Earth years (1998, 2008, 2018) can bring crisis or unfavorable change, while Yin Earth years (1999, 2009, 2019) bring beneficial or positive change, especially in work or business matters.

If your daymaster is the Water Rat, you are deeply emotional, know how to communicate, and can easily influence a crowd. You are an open-minded individual, always looking for new ideas and experiences. Sensitive and capable of empathizing with others, communication, learning, and travel are all important to you. With a fine vocabulary and vivid imagination, you may excel in language, writing, or journalism.

If your daymaster is the Water Tiger, you are self-motivated, with a great desire to communicate, teach, and lead. You are a natural intermediary and may be drawn to public relations. Humanitarian, empathic, and morally upright, you have been blessed with sensible insight into human nature and a "sixth sense." Those with a Water Tiger daymaster are exquisitely insightful and may choose to pursue positions of spiritual leadership.

If your daymaster is the Water Dragon, you are humane and an excellent judge of the truth. You would excel in any type of career involving public affairs, social relations, or public speaking. Always open to new ideas and experiences, you have a true gift for seeing things objectively and creating a foundation to build upon in all that you do. Your urge to communicate may be expressed in a love of travel and embracing different cultures. Outgoing, fluent, and a first-rate conversationalist, you may chart your course to exotic locations. Careers that involve theatrics and playing to an admiring audience suit you best.

If your daymaster is the Water Horse, you are always seeking new ideas and experiences. You advance your own ideas by influencing the opinions and thoughts of others. Open-minded, objective, and friendly, you possess an insatiable need for movement, communication, and decisive action. You have a love of the outdoors and may lean toward team sports. You follow the latest trends and want to be the first to learn of and pass on news.

If your daymaster is the Water Monkey, you rarely take yourself too seriously and are generally full of humor and good cheer. The Water element imparts a great need to communicate with others. You cannot tolerate boredom, routine, or stagnation of your keen mind; you need to be challenged and stimulated mentally. Watch a tendency to be suspicious, and to leverage a response using your gifts of influence and persuasion. Your ability to manipulate language, ideas, and tricky situations is uncanny.

If your daymaster is the Water Dog, you are empathetic, tenderhearted, and capable of great sacrifice. Talented and intuitive, you could be very persuasive for the right cause. Others see you as kind, compassionate, and loyal. You are an exceptionally scrupulous and virtuous individual whose principal quality is devotion. Occasionally lacking self-confidence, you are very emotional and need a lot of encouragement and emotional support from others to assuage your fears, worries, and self-doubts.
